Challenges and opportunities in the insertion of adolescents in the labor market

The integration of adolescents into society is a complex current issue. Young people face a changing work environment, driven by technological advances and specific skills. This dynamic requires a solid education, not always accessible, making the professional trajectory more challenging. Policies aimed at training young people, such as internships and training, are crucial. However, socioeconomic factors lead many to work early, often in informal conditions, threatening the educational and professional future of many adolescents. Based on this context, the complex issue of the insertion of adolescents in Brazilian society is investigated. The study adopts the analysis through a systematic review, revealing that, despite the opportunities through training programs, there are significant socioeconomic barriers. The research concludes that there is a need for more effective policies to better prepare adolescents for the labor market.
